I. Introduction

    The U.S. Nuclear Regulatory Commission (NRC) has issued revisions 
to existing guides in the agency's ``Regulatory Guide'' series. This 
series was developed to describe and make available to the public 
information such as methods that are acceptable to the NRC staff for 
implementing specific parts of the agency's regulations, techniques 
that the staff uses in evaluating specific problems or postulated 
accidents, and data that the staff needs in its review of applications 
for permits and licenses.
    Revision 1 of Regulatory Guide 3.66, ``Standard Format and Content 
of Financial Assurance Mechanisms,'' was issued with a temporary 
identification as Draft Regulatory Guide DG-3028. This regulatory guide 
provides guidance for the financial assurance mechanisms required for 
decommissioning leading to termination of a materials license. At the 
end of licensed operations, licensees must maintain all financial 
assurance established pursuant to Title 10 of the Code of Federal 
Regulations (10 CFR). In particular, licensees are required to 
demonstrate compliance with the following parts of 10 CFR:
     Part 30, ``Rules of General Applicability to Domestic 
Licensing of Byproduct Material'';
     Part 40, ``Domestic Licensing of Source Material'';
     Part 70, ``Domestic Licensing of Special Nuclear 
Material'';
     Part 72, ``Licensing Requirements for the Independent 
Storage of Spent Nuclear Fuel and High-Level Radioactive Waste, and 
Reactor Related Greater Than Class C Waste''.
    NRC licensees must demonstrate financial assurance for 
decommissioning and, if applicable, for site control and maintenance 
following license termination.
    This regulatory guide endorses the method described in the current 
revisions of NUREG-1757, Volume 1, ``Consolidated Decommissioning 
Guidance: Decommissioning Process for Materials Licensees'' and Volume 
3, ``Consolidated NMSS Decommissioning Guidance: Financial Assurance, 
Recordkeeping, and Timeliness'' as a process that has been found 
acceptable to the NRC for meeting the regulatory requirements.
